Looking for a good option to pursue your educational dreams in Kenner, LA? Healthcare Training Institute has you covered. With all the things you’d find in the Southeast region of the United States, you’ll surely be satisfied along with the 80 other students that attend this school.
Address: 322 Williams Boulevard Kenner, LA 70062 | Website

When you apply to Healthcare Training Institute
Quick Fact #1 | ![]() |
You can apply year round to this school… it’s always in session! |
Quick Fact #2 | ![]() |
Learning institutions such as this one rarely need SAT or ACT scores, but may require other aptitude tests. |
Fun Fact #1 | ![]() |
If you’re interested, this school says that 86% of its students are full-time and 14% are part-time. |
Fun Fact #2 | ![]() |
Is the average age of the student here a factor in your consideration of this school? We gotchu — it’s 29. |
